Java Weekly, Ausgabe 200

1. Frühling und Java

>> Aktivieren der Zwei-Faktor-Authentifizierung für Ihre Webanwendung []

Ein schnelles und praktisches Beispiel für eine 2FA-Implementierung mit Spring.

>> Erstellen von JAR-Dateien mit mehreren Versionen in IntelliJ IDEA []

Mit IntelliJ IDEA können JDK 9-JARs mit mehreren Versionen ganz einfach genutzt werden.

>> Leistungsmessung mit JMH - Java Microbenchmark Harness []

Das Benchmarking der JVM-Anwendung kann aufgrund von Laufzeitoptimierungen schwierig sein, aber die Verwendung von JMH macht es einfach. **

>> JSR 305 auf Java 9 arbeiten lassen []

Das Mischen von JSR 305- und javax.annotation -Annotationen ist nicht offensichtlich - aber durchaus machbar.

>> Testen von Spring Cloud Stream-Anwendungen Teil I) []

SpringRunner (von Spring Testing Framework), Boot-Autokonfiguration für die Testumgebung und Mocks von Spring Integration - alle machen Integrationstests nicht mehr so ​​schwierig.

Auch lesenswert:

2. Technik und Überlegungen

Ein umfassender Vergleich der meisten auf dem Markt verfügbaren CI-Tools.

** >> Wissen, was da ist

Ein aufschlussreicher Bericht über die Denkweise des Aufbaus und der Entwicklung eines Systems

Dies ist die Art von Einblick, die Sie nur mit Erfahrung und Misserfolg erhalten können.

3. Comics

Und meine Lieblings-Dilberts der Woche: